@butterfly123 wrote:I am not skilled with tech. So when you have read the post the talk bubble changes?
Yes, @butterfly123. If you haven't read all the posts within the thread, the bubble is darkened. If you have read all the responses, the bubble isn't filled in.
eta: If you have posted on a thread, you'll see the arrow instead of the bubble. In that case, the only indicator that you've read all the posts is that the subject line of the post will no longer be in bold letters.
